This charming Village Colonial was updated and expanded in 1998. The home is nicely tucked back on the lot, offering a sense of privacy from the street. The level yard is ideal for family activities, and the detached two-car garage is a real bonus—especially during New England winters. Directly abuts the Bruce Freeman Trail, just minutes to West Concord Village & the T to Boston! The first floor offers very functional living space, with a formal living room and dining room that open to a spacious, open-plan kitchen and family room—perfect for both everyday living and entertaining. A study at the rear of the house is ideal for working from home, and a large mudroom along with a powder room and laundry complete the main level. The second floor features a spacious primary suite with a full bath and walk-in closet, along with three additional family bedrooms and a shared bath. Nicely updated and expanded with classic details and the perfect location for young families, down-sizers, et al!— Compass

National Historic Landmark

Federally designated as nationally significant — the highest U.S. historic recognition. Section 106 review applies to federal undertakings affecting the property.

National Register

List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Owners may qualify for the 20% federal Historic Rehabilitation Tax Credit on certified rehabilitation work.

State Register

Listed on the Massachusetts State Register of Historic Places.

Local Historic District

Inside a Local Historic District. Exterior changes visible from a public way require approval from the local historic district commission.

Local Landmark

Individually designated by the town as a local landmark. Exterior alterations require commission approval.

MACRIS Inventory

Documented in MACRIS, the state historic inventory. Informational only — no regulatory constraints.

Article 85 (Boston)

Subject to Boston Article 85 demolition-delay review, which can pause demolition of buildings 50+ years old for up to 90 days.

Ch. 91 Waterways License

An active MassDEP permit for a dock, pier, seawall, or other structure on or over a Massachusetts waterway. Many older licenses are not digitized; this record is provided for reference only.

Massachusetts Great Pond

A Great Pond under M.G.L. Ch. 91 — the Commonwealth retains public rights to fish and navigate these state-designated waters. Private docks and other waterfront structures require a Waterways License from MassDEP.

Likely Great Pond

The MLS listing describes this property as being on a Great Pond, which would be a state-designated water body under M.G.L. Ch. 91. GIS data did not independently confirm the pond name — verification needed.
